Dry cell thawers, unlike traditional methods that may involve water baths or air thawing, provide rapid and uniform thawing of frozen samples, particularly those in cryogenic storage. They utilize advanced thermal technology to precisely control the temperature, ensuring that samples are thawed quickly and evenly, thereby retaining their integrity and viability. This capability is increasingly sought after by laboratories globally, especially those dealing with sensitive biological materials such as cells, tissues, and proteins.

In recent years, the trend towards automation in laboratories has gained momentum. With the advent of smart thawing systems that incorporate software for tracking and managing thawing processes, the demand for dry cell thawers equipped with these features has surged. Buyers are increasingly inclined towards models that offer advanced functionalities, such as programmable settings and real-time monitoring, which collectively enhance productivity and minimize human error.

The return on investment (ROI) attained from implementing dry cell thawers is substantial. By enabling faster processing times, these devices not only enhance the workflow but also allow for more samples to be handled in a shorter period. This increased throughput translates to higher productivity and ultimately can lead to quicker research results, setting a crucial advantage in both academic and commercial endeavors.
Moreover, minimizing the risk of sample degradation during thawing has significant implications for data accuracy and reliability. For laboratories involved in critical research or product development, having dependable thawing technology that ensures the integrity of samples can be the difference between success and failure.
